Works fine and so far and has been weatherproof. Easy to setup with no special skills (reading labels on unit only).
It is not overly powerful so don't attempt to drive more than a small pair of outdoor speakers with it. I am using it on my patio and I will be making a small box for it to sit in.
The tuner works well as do the inputs for outside sources. I did not however try out a microphone.
Considering the price of this item it's not a bad deal. Although it is designed for outdoor use the power supply states that it should not be subject to wet conditions.
My main complaint is that it arrived with no instructions. Other than that the unit is as described.
